Article: Jobless Rate Falls to 4.8 Percent in Fort Wayne, Ind.

Aug. 1--FORT WAYNE, Ind.--The jobless rate fell to 4.8 percent in the Fort Wayne metro area in June, as the unemployment rate fell in almost every county in northeast Indiana. The two exceptions were Allen and LaGrange counties, where the jobless rate was unchanged.

Huntington and Steuben counties recorded the steepest declines in their unemployment rates, both down 0.6 percentage point. Steuben County, which has been hit hard by the manufacturing recession, still has the highest unemployment rate in the area -- 5.8 percent in June.

The jobless rate for the city of Fort Wayne was 6.3 percent, much higher than Allen County or the region as a whole.
